SB 2900

Hawaii - Session 2026

Senate failed 2026-02-17
Bill Details

Title: Attorney General; Sports Officials; Public Schools; Private Schools; Civil Proceedings; Felony

Summary

Authorizes the Attorney General to represent sports officials in civil proceedings if the sports official has been assaulted or threatened in the course of legally discharging their sports official duties. Makes intentional bodily injury of a sports official engaged in the lawful discharge of the sports official's duties a class B felony. Clarifies that a sports official includes a school or league administrator. Clarifies that a sports official's duties cover sports events at public schools and private schools.
